BRAKE VARIATION DERIVED CONTROLLER RE-SET SCHEDULE
A method for controlling a braking operation applied to a wheel of a wheel assembly includes receiving a command signal in proportion to an amount of braking requested at an input device; outputting a control signal in proportion to the command signal; receiving a wheel speed signal indicative of a speed of the wheel; calculating an adjustment signal in proportion to the wheel speed signal; providing a modified control signal to a brake actuator based on the control signal and the adjustment signal; and continually resetting a reset schedule based on the wheel speed signal.
